People at Mission Santa Cruz survived primarily through agriculture and livestock farming. They cultivated crops such as wheat, barley, and various fruits while raising animals like cattle, sheep, and pigs for food. The mission also served as a community hub, where Native Americans were taught skills and trades to support their livelihoods. Additionally, the mission provided religious guidance and a sense of community, which helped the residents cope with the challenges of their environment.
